President and Provost’s Funding for Institutionally Related Research
The President and Provost’s Fund supports faculty-led research projects related to the University’s strategic plan, with an emphasis on improving the experiences of students, faculty and staff – anything that could improve life and learning at UVA. The fund has a total pool of $700,000, with a cap of $200,000 per award. Applications are due January 15, 2021.
4-VA at UVA Collaborative Research Grant Opportunity
Letters of intent (LOI) are now being accepted for the 2021 4-VA Collaborative Research Grant program. Each UVA Collaborative Research Grant proposal may request up to $25,000 in funding from 4-VA at UVA.

Academic Affairs leads and oversees UVA’s curriculum, academic planning and program review, and develops and implements strategic policies and practices that define and pursue future academic priorities. These efforts include working with the schools and the faculty on initiatives that enhance the undergraduate, graduate, and professional student experience.
